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by Banco Bradesco S.A. (Bank Bradesco) was submitted on October 5, 2006. The document announces the approval by the Board of Directors and Special Stockholders' Meeting of a capital increase proposal. The filing details the extension of the deadline for stockholders to exercise subscription rights from November 20, 2006, to November 21, 2006.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ide standard financial performance metrics such as rev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t levels, or liquidity ratios for the period ending December 31, 2006, or the current reporting period. The document focuses exclusively on capital structure changes.
- Capital Increase Amount: R$1,200,000,000.00
- Subscription Price: R$55.00 per stock
- New Shares Issued: 21,818,182 total (10,909,152 common; 10,909,030 preferred)
- Preemptive Right Ratio: 2.226746958% of stockholding position as of October 5, 2006
- Payment Date: December 7, 2006
Material Changes
The primary material change is the extension of the subscription period for the capital increase. Previously set to end on November 20, 2006, the deadline for exercising preemptive rights has been extended to November 21, 2006. Additionally, the filing clarifies that payment for subscribed stocks will occur on December 7, 2006, coinciding with the payment of Complementary Interest on Own Capital and Dividends.
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
Management Commentary: The company clarified payment options for stockholders, including the ability to offset the subscription cost with credits from Complementary Interest on Own Capital and Dividends, debit from checking accounts, or payment by check. Unsubscribed shares will be sold via auction on the São Paulo Stock Exchange (BOVESPA).
Contingencies: The effectiveness of these deliberations is contingent upon approval by the Central Bank of Brazil. New shares will only be entitled to dividends and interest after this regulatory approval and subsequent inclusion in the stockholders' position.

Investor Verification Checklist
- Verify the final approval status of the capital increase by the Central Bank of Brazil.
- Confirm the exact number of shares held as of the record date (October 5, 2006) to calculate the specific number of subscription rights available.
- Check the deadline for depositing subscription reports at brokerage houses (November 16, 2006) versus bank branches (November 21, 2006).
- Review the market price of subscription rights on BOVESPA if intending to sell rather than exercise them (trading ends November 10, 2006).
- Confirm the availability of Complementary Interest and Dividend credits to offset the R$55.00 per share payment obligation.
